The most crucial element to any chant is of course the group of fans involved, unless they are passionate and vocal, no chant will have the desired effect. Those who have witnessed or been involved in the powerful performance of a chant will understand how special it can be, the atmosphere it can create and the genuine effect that it can have upon the field of play. The tune for chants is most ordinarily a simple one which can be easily latched on to and sung by all they are drawn from all kinds of sources, including hymns, classical music, folk songs, nursery rhymes and more recently, pop songs. Some songs and chants can date back over 100 years and were sung by members of the crowds grandfathers, whilst others can start spontaneously for the oddest of reasons and become enshrined in the team or clubs tradition forever more. ![]() Sports chants have a number of different intentions including humor, intimidation and motivation. There is something beautiful about being part of a group chant or song, and as the number of people attending church continues to drop, sports chants are actually one of very few examples of spontaneous group singing and of the oral folk song tradition. Sports chants may seem like nothing more than a crowd of people getting a bit rowdy at times, but in truth, it is a valuable tradition which runs far deeper than that.
